cesta k aktuálnímu uživateli   zodpovězená otázka

VB6/VBA

Zdravím,

potřeboval bych nějakým způsobem dostat do cesty k souboru aktuální uživatelské jméno a nevím, jak to napsat. Mám:

C:\Documents and Settings\jméno\data aplikací\... a místo jména dostat aktuálního uživatele.. Jsem začátečník, díky.

nahlásit spamnahlásit spam 0 odpovědětodpovědět

Zjistit jméno přihlášeného uživatele lze takto:

Dim username As String = System.Environment.UserName
nahlásit spamnahlásit spam 0 odpovědětodpovědět

Zapoměl jsem dodat, že horní řešení není pro VB 6.

nahlásit spamnahlásit spam 0 odpovědětodpovědět

Nikdy nezískávejte cestu skládáním Documents and Settings + něco, vždy použijte systémové proměnné. Následující kód by měl fungovat i ve VB6:

Dim userProfilePath As String
userProfilePath = Environ("USERPROFILE")
nahlásit spamnahlásit spam 2 / 2 odpovědětodpovědět
                       
Nadpis:
Antispam: Komu se občas házejí perly?
Příspěvek bude publikován pod identitou   anonym.
  • Administrátoři si vyhrazují právo komentáře upravovat či mazat bez udání důvodu.
    Mazány budou zejména komentáře obsahující vulgarity nebo porušující pravidla publikování.
  • Pokud nejste zaregistrováni, Vaše IP adresa bude zveřejněna. Pokud s tímto nesouhlasíte, příspěvek neodesílejte.

přihlásit pomocí externího účtu

přihlásit pomocí jména a hesla

Uživatel:
Heslo:

zapomenuté heslo

 

založit nový uživatelský účet

zaregistrujte se

 
zavřít

Nahlásit spam

Opravdu chcete tento příspěvek nahlásit pro porušování pravidel fóra?

Nahlásit Zrušit

Chyba

zavřít

feedback